Automata: A Historical and Technological Study by Alfred Chapuis & Edmond Droz. Translated by Alec Reid.
Published 1958, Neuchatel, Switzerland by B.T. Batsford.
407 pages. Text in English. Profusely illustrated throughout, including color plates.

A monumental, well illustrated and detailed look at these types of objects, still useful and among the best references on the subject.

Publisher's cloth binding, gilt title lettering, gilt cover decorations & ruling.
